Saphara supports many of the children in schools who live in marginalised communities with extremely poor living conditions; lack of hygiene and limited resources. As a result of the current pandemic, COVID-19, the children are more vulnerable now than ever. Many of the children did not have adequate online learning provisions at home as therefor they missed out on a vital, almost 2 years, of education. Every £100 that I raise will provide a child in India with a full year education which includes a uniform, books, a school meal, and it also goes towards providing pay for the teachers who make as little as £3 an hour (some months without pay at all).
